SCHEDULE “A”

 

(share structure)

 

The Corporation is authorized to issue an unlimited number of Common Shares. The rights, privileges, restrictions and conditions attached to the Common Shares are as follows:

 

(a)                                 The holders of the Common Shares shall be entitled to receive notice of, attend at and vote at any meeting of the shareholders of the Corporation on the basis of one vote for each Common Share held at the time of any such meeting;

 

(b)                                 The holders of the Common Shares shall be entitled to receive dividends declared as and if declared by the Board of Directors; and

 

(c)                                  The holders of the Common Shares shall be entitled to share in the remaining property of the Corporation upon liquidation, dissolution, bankruptcy, winding-up or other distribution of the assets of the Corporation among its shareholders for the purpose of winding-up its affairs.

SCHEDULE “B”

 

(restrictions on share transfers)

 

No securities of the Corporation, other than non-convertible debt securities, shall be transferred without the consent of either (a) a majority of the directors of the Corporation expressed by a resolution passed at a meeting of the board of directors or by an instrument or instruments in writing signed by a majority of the directors, or (b) the holders of a majority of the outstanding shares of the Corporation entitling the holders thereof to vote in all circumstances (other than a separate class vote of the holders of another class of shares of the Corporation) expressed by a resolution passed at a meeting of such shareholders or by an instrument or instruments in writing signed by the holders of a majority of such shares.

SCHEDULE “C”

 

(other rules or provisions)

 

1.                                      The number of shareholders of the Corporation, exclusive of persons who are in its employment and are shareholders of the Corporation and exclusive of persons who, having been formerly in the employment of the Corporation, were, while in that employment, shareholders of the Corporation, and have continued to be shareholders of the Corporation after termination of that employment, is limited to not more than fifty persons, two or more persons who are the joint registered owners of one or more shares being counted as one shareholder.

 

2.                                      Any invitation to the public to subscribe for securities of the Corporation is prohibited.

 

3.                                      The directors may, between annual general meetings, appoint one or more additional directors of the Corporation to serve until the next annual meeting, but the number of additional directors shall not at any time exceed one-third of the number of directors who held office at the expiration of the last annual meeting of the Corporation.

 

4.                                      The liability of each of the shareholders of the unlimited liability corporation for any liability, act or default of the unlimited liability corporation is unlimited in extent and joint and several in nature.

ARTICLES OF AMENDMENT

Business Corporations Act

Section 29 or 177

 

1.

 

NAME OF CORPORATION:

2.

CORPORATE ACCESS NO.

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

KINDER MORGAN CANADA GP ULC

 

2020465411

 

3.                                      THE ARTICLES OF THE ABOVE-NAMED CORPORATION ARE AMENDED AS FOLLOWS:

 

A.                                    Pursuant to Section 173(1)(a) of the Business Corporations Act (Alberta) the Articles be amended by changing the name of the Corporation from “KINDER MORGAN CANADA GP ULC” to “KINDER MORGAN CANADA GP INC.”;

 

B.                                    By deleting and adding Other Rules or Provisions as follows:

 

i)                                         pursuant to Section 173(1)(m.1) of the Business Corporations Act (Alberta) the Articles be amended by deleting paragraph 4 of the current other rules and provisions, which states:

 

“4.                                The liability of each of the shareholders of the unlimited liability Corporation for any liability, act or default of the unlimited liability Corporation is unlimited in extent and joint and several in nature.”; and

 

ii)                                      pursuant to Section 173(1)(n) of the Business Corporations Act (Alberta) the Articles be amended by adding the following paragraph to the current other rules and provisions, which states:

 

“4.                                The Corporation has a lien on the shares of a shareholder or his legal representative for a debt of that shareholder to the Corporation, provided that such lien shall be released in respect of shares transferred by such shareholder (or his legal representative) as permitted pursuant to the terms of these Articles or any unanimous shareholders agreement in respect of the Corporation.”;

 

so that the current Schedule “C” is hereby replaced with the Schedule “C” attached to these Articles of Amendment.

SHARES IN SERIES SCHEDULE

 

The first series of Preferred Shares of the Corporation shall consist of 12,000,000 shares designated as Preferred Shares, Series 1 (the “Series 1 Shares”). In addition to the rights, privileges, restrictions and conditions attaching to the Preferred Shares as a class, the rights, privileges, restrictions and conditions attaching to the Series 1 Shares shall be as follows:

 

1.                                      Interpretation

 

In these Series 1 Share provisions, the following terms have the meanings indicated:

 

(a)                                 “Dividend Amount” means the amount per Series 1 Share equal to the quotient of the aggregate dividend amount payable by KML in respect of all Series 1 KML Preferred Shares and Series 2 KML Preferred Shares outstanding on the relevant Dividend Payment Date divided by the number of Series 1 Shares outstanding;

 

(b)                                 “Dividend Payment Date” means the 15th day of February, May, August and November in any year or any other date on which a payment is made by KML to the holders of all Series 1 KML Preferred Shares and Series 2 KML Preferred Shares then outstanding in respect of dividends declared on such shares in accordance with the terms thereof;

 

(c)                                  “KML” means Kinder Morgan Canada Limited, a corporation existing under the laws of the Province of Alberta;

 

(d)                                 “KML Preferred Shares” means any series of preferred shares in the capital of KML as set forth in the articles of incorporation, amendment, arrangement or amalgamation of KML, from time to time;

 

(e)                                  “Liquidation” means the liquidation, dissolution or winding-up of the Corporation, whether voluntary or involuntary, or any other distribution of assets of the Corporation among its shareholders for the purpose of winding up its affairs;

 

(f)                                   “Preferred Shares” means the Preferred Shares of the Corporation;

 

(g)                                  “Series 1 KML Preferred Shares” means the first series of KML Preferred Shares designated as Cumulative Redeemable Minimum Rate Reset Preferred Shares, Series 1; and

 

(h)                                 “Series 2 KML Preferred Shares” means the first series of KML Preferred Shares designated as Cumulative Redeemable Floating Rate Preferred Shares, Series 2.

 

2.                                      Dividends

 

(a)                                 The holders of the Series 1 Shares shall be entitled to receive cash dividends in the amount per share equal to the Dividend Amount on each applicable Distribution Payment Date.

 



 

(b)                                 If the dividends payable pursuant to paragraph (2)(a) are not paid in full on all of the Series 1 Shares then outstanding, such Dividend Amount or the unpaid part of it shall be paid on a subsequent date or dates to be determined by the board of directors of the Corporation on which the Corporation shall have sufficient moneys properly applicable, under the provisions of any applicable law and under the provisions of any trust indenture securing bonds, debentures or other securities of the Corporation, to the payment of the dividend.

 

(c)                                  The holders of the Series 1 Shares shall not be entitled to any dividends other than as specified in this paragraph (Error! Reference source not found.).

 

3.                                      Purchase for Cancellation

 

Subject to such provisions of the Business Corporations Act (Alberta) as may be applicable, the Corporation shall purchase for cancellation the number of Series 1 Shares equal to the number of Series 1 KML Preferred Shares or Series 2 KML Preferred Shares purchased for cancellation by KML in accordance with the terms thereof and at the same purchase price.

 

4.                                      Liquidation, Dissolution or Winding-up

 

In the event of a Liquidation, the holders of the Series 1 Shares shall be entitled to receive $25.00 per Series 1 Share plus all accrued and unpaid dividends thereon, which for such purpose shall be calculated on a pro rata basis for the period from and including the last Dividend Payment Date on which dividends on the Series 1 Shares have been paid to but excluding the date of such Liquidation, before any amount shall be paid or any property or assets of the Corporation shall be distributed to the holders of the common shares of the Corporation or to the holders of any other shares of the Corporation ranking junior to the Series 1 Shares in any respect. After payment to the holders of the Series 1 Shares of the amount so payable to them, they shall not, as such, be entitled to share in any further distribution of the property or assets of the Corporation.

 

5.                                      Voting Rights

 

The holders of Series 1 Shares shall not be entitled, except as otherwise provided by law, to receive notice of, attend at, or vote at any meeting of shareholders of the Corporation.

 

6.                                      Restrictions on Payment of Dividends and Reduction of Junior Capital

 

So long as any of the Series 1 Shares are outstanding, the Corporation shall not:

 

(a)                                 call for redemption, purchase, reduce or otherwise pay off less than all the Series 1 Shares and all other Preferred Shares then outstanding ranking prior to or on parity with the Series 1 Shares with respect to payment of dividends;

 

(b)                                 declare, pay or set apart for payment, any dividends (other than stock dividends in shares of the Corporation ranking junior to the Series 1 Shares) on the common shares of the Corporation or any other shares of the Corporation ranking junior to the Series 1 Shares with respect to payment of dividends; or

 



 

(c)                                  call for redemption, purchase, reduce or otherwise pay for any shares of the Corporation ranking junior to the Series 1 Shares with respect to repayment of capital or with respect to payment of dividends;

 

unless all dividends up to and including the dividends payable on the last preceding dividend payment dates on the Series 1 Shares and on all other Preferred Shares ranking prior to or on a parity with the Series 1 Shares with respect to payment of dividends then outstanding shall have been declared and paid or set apart for payment at the date of any such action referred to in subparagraphs 6 0, 0 and 0.

 

7.                                      Withholding Tax

 

Notwithstanding any other provision contained in this Exhibit “1”, the Corporation may deduct or withhold from any payment, distribution, issuance or delivery (whether in cash or in shares) to be made pursuant to any of the provisions in this Exhibit “1” any amounts required or permitted by law to be deducted or withheld from any such payment, distribution, issuance or delivery and shall remit any such amounts to the relevant tax authority as required. If the cash component of any payment, distribution, issuance or delivery to be made pursuant to this Exhibit “1” is less than the amount that the Corporation is so required or permitted to deduct or withhold, the Corporation shall be permitted to deduct and withhold from any non-cash payment, distribution, issuance or delivery to be made pursuant to this Exhibit “1” any amounts required or permitted by law to be deducted or withheld from any such payment, distribution, issuance or delivery and to dispose of such property in order to remit any amount required to be remitted to any relevant tax authority. Notwithstanding the foregoing, the amount of any payment, distribution, issuance or delivery made to a holder of Series 1 Shares pursuant to provisions of this Exhibit “1” shall be considered to be the amount of the payment, distribution, issuance or delivery received by such holder plus any amount deducted or withheld pursuant to this paragraph (7). Holders of Series 1 Shares shall be responsible for all withholding taxes under Part XIII of the Income Tax Act in respect of any payment, distribution, issuance or delivery made or credited to them pursuant to provisions of this Exhibit “1” and shall indemnify and hold harmless the Corporation on an after-tax basis for any such taxes imposed on any payment, distribution, issuance or delivery made or credited to them.

 

8.                                      Amendments

 

The provisions attaching to the Series 1 Shares may be deleted, varied, modified, amended or amplified by articles of amendment with such approval as may then be required by the Business Corporations Act (Alberta).
